// We have N evidence reactors connected to one another. The first reactor
// receives a number of evidence at varying heights. We test that all
// other reactors receive the evidence and add it to their own respective
// evidence pools.
func TestReactorBroadcastEvidence(t *testing.T) {
config := cfg.TestConfig()
N := 7
// create statedb for everyone
stateDBs := make([]sm.Store, N)
val := types.NewMockPV()
// we need validators saved for heights at least as high as we have evidence for
height := int64(numEvidence) + 10
for i := 0; i < N; i++ {
stateDBs[i] = initializeValidatorState(val, height)
}
// make reactors from statedb
reactors, pools := makeAndConnectReactorsAndPools(config, stateDBs)
// set the peer height on each reactor
for _, r := range reactors {
for _, peer := range r.Switch.Peers().List() {
ps := peerState{height}
peer.Set(types.PeerStateKey, ps)
}
}
// send a bunch of valid evidence to the first reactor's evpool
// and wait for them all to be received in the others
evList := sendEvidence(t, pools[0], val, numEvidence)
waitForEvidence(t, evList, pools)
}
// We have two evidence reactors connected to one another but are at different heights.
// Reactor 1 which is ahead receives a number of evidence. It should only send the evidence
// that is below the height of the peer to that peer.
func TestReactorSelectiveBroadcast(t *testing.T) {
config := cfg.TestConfig()
val := types.NewMockPV()
height1 := int64(numEvidence) + 10
height2 := int64(numEvidence) / 2
// DB1 is ahead of DB2
stateDB1 := initializeValidatorState(val, height1)
stateDB2 := initializeValidatorState(val, height2)
// make reactors from statedb
reactors, pools := makeAndConnectReactorsAndPools(config, []sm.Store{stateDB1, stateDB2})
// set the peer height on each reactor
for _, r := range reactors {
for _, peer := range r.Switch.Peers().List() {
ps := peerState{height1}
peer.Set(types.PeerStateKey, ps)
}
}
// update the first reactor peer's height to be very small
peer := reactors[0].Switch.Peers().List()[0]
ps := peerState{height2}
peer.Set(types.PeerStateKey, ps)
// send a bunch of valid evidence to the first reactor's evpool
evList := sendEvidence(t, pools[0], val, numEvidence)
// only ones less than the peers height should make it through
waitForEvidence(t, evList[:numEvidence/2-1], []*evidence.Pool{pools[1]})
// peers should still be connected
peers := reactors[1].Switch.Peers().List()
assert.Equal(t, 1, len(peers))
}
// This tests aims to ensure that reactors don't send evidence that they have committed or that ar
// not ready for the peer through three scenarios.
// First, committed evidence to a newly connected peer
// Second, evidence to a peer that is behind
// Third, evidence that was pending and became committed just before the peer caught up
func TestReactorsGossipNoCommittedEvidence(t *testing.T) {
config := cfg.TestConfig()
val := types.NewMockPV()
var height int64 = 10
// DB1 is ahead of DB2
stateDB1 := initializeValidatorState(val, height-1)
stateDB2 := initializeValidatorState(val, height-2)
state, err := stateDB1.Load()
require.NoError(t, err)
state.LastBlockHeight++
// make reactors from statedb
reactors, pools := makeAndConnectReactorsAndPools(config, []sm.Store{stateDB1, stateDB2})
evList := sendEvidence(t, pools[0], val, 2)
pools[0].Update(state, evList)
require.EqualValues(t, uint32(0), pools[0].Size())
time.Sleep(100 * time.Millisecond)
peer := reactors[0].Switch.Peers().List()[0]
ps := peerState{height - 2}
peer.Set(types.PeerStateKey, ps)
peer = reactors[1].Switch.Peers().List()[0]
ps = peerState{height}
peer.Set(types.PeerStateKey, ps)
// wait to see that no evidence comes through
time.Sleep(300 * time.Millisecond)
// the second pool should not have received any evidence because it has already been committed
assert.Equal(t, uint32(0), pools[1].Size(), "second reactor should not have received evidence")
// the first reactor receives three more evidence
evList = make([]types.Evidence, 3)
for i := 0; i < 3; i++ {
ev := types.NewMockDuplicateVoteEvidenceWithValidator(height-3+int64(i),
time.Date(2019, 1, 1, 0, 0, 0, 0, time.UTC), val, state.ChainID)
err := pools[0].AddEvidence(ev)
require.NoError(t, err)
evList[i] = ev
}
// wait to see that only one evidence is sent
time.Sleep(300 * time.Millisecond)
// the second pool should only have received the first evidence because it is behind
peerEv, _ := pools[1].PendingEvidence(10000)
assert.EqualValues(t, []types.Evidence{evList[0]}, peerEv)
// the last evidence is committed and the second reactor catches up in state to the first
// reactor. We therefore expect that the second reactor only receives one more evidence, the
// one that is still pending and not the evidence that has already been committed.
state.LastBlockHeight++
pools[0].Update(state, []types.Evidence{evList[2]})
// the first reactor should have the two remaining pending evidence
require.EqualValues(t, uint32(2), pools[0].Size())
// now update the state of the second reactor
pools[1].Update(state, types.EvidenceList{})
peer = reactors[0].Switch.Peers().List()[0]
ps = peerState{height}
peer.Set(types.PeerStateKey, ps)
// wait to see that only two evidence is sent
time.Sleep(300 * time.Millisecond)
peerEv, _ = pools[1].PendingEvidence(1000)
assert.EqualValues(t, []types.Evidence{evList[0], evList[1]}, peerEv)
}
